Chivas Femenil has consolidated a strong identity under the guidance of Antonio Contreras, a formula that has paid off in the Clausura 2026 and that the team will look to reaffirm this Sunday when they host León on Matchday 6 of the Liga MX Femenil. It will be a matchup with a special edge, as Guadalajara faces an opponent it has historically dominated in Tapatío territory.

What is Chivas Femenil’s streak against León?
The history is flawless: Chivas Femenil holds a perfect home record against León. On Rojiblanco ground, the two sides have met 10 times, and every single match has ended in victory for the Chiverío.
What has the goal balance been like?
That dominance is also reflected in the attacking numbers. Of the 52 goals the Rebaño Femenil has scored against León, 27 have come in matches played in Jalisco, where they have also conceded just six goals. In other words, the figures show not only that the tapatías know how to shut things down defensively, but also that they consistently find the back of the net.
What was the first meeting in Guadalajara?
The first clash between the two sides on Chiverío home soil took place on Matchday 14 of the Apertura 2017, a match that went down as one of the most lopsided wins in the rivalry: a convincing 4–0 victory for Guadalajara.
And the most recent meeting?
The most recent home encounter came on Matchday 2 of the Apertura 2024, when the Rojiblancas claimed a 2–1 win in a high-intensity match, with goals from Alicia Cervantes and Gabriela Valenzuela.
With this history as their backing, the clash against León represents another opportunity for Chivas Femenil to reaffirm their strong form in the Clausura 2026 and once again make their home dominance over León count in Liga MX Femenil.
Home matches between the Rebaño and the Esmeraldas
Tournament (Matchday) / Result
AP24 (MD2) / Chivas Femenil 2–1 León FemenilAP23 (MD14) / Chivas Femenil 2–0 León FemenilCL23 (MD13) / Chivas Femenil 3–0 León FemenilAP21 (MD3) / Chivas Femenil 2–1 León FemenilCL21 (MD8) / Chivas Femenil 5–1 León FemenilCL20 (MD3) / Chivas Femenil 4–1 León FemenilCL19 (MD1) / Chivas Femenil 2–0 León FemenilAP18 (MD1) / Chivas Femenil 1–0 León FemenilCL18 (MD14) / Chivas Femenil 2–0 León FemenilAP17 (MD14) / Chivas Femenil 4–0 León Femenil
